In 2024, we expect key pharmaceutical companies to see patent expiries for their drugs, which will cause reduced revenue and an increase in generic manufacturing of these drugs and more competition. Notable drugs that are open to generic competition in 2024 include Novo Nordisk’s Victoza (liraglutide), an anti-diabetic medication used to treat type 2 diabetes (T2D) and chronic obesity. Liraglutide is a glucagon-like peptide-1 (GLP-1) agonist, which has recently become a highly sought-after class of drug, with much media attention.

In 2024, the global market for generic drugs is projected to increase by USD3bn, a growth rate of 6.7% from 2023, bringing total sales to an estimated USD51bn. This growth is anticipated to be particularly strong in the Asia-Pacific (APAC) region (10% in 2024 to USD246bn), led by Mainland China and supported by wider demographic shifts and economic growth.

Access to high-quality generic medications continues to be a pivotal issue across the globe in 2024, with various regions deploying targeted strategies to overcome barriers to affordability and quality. Many patients in conflict zones and low-income countries have limited pharmaceutical manufacturing and are heavily reliant upon imports to access generics. Weak regulatory systems in many sub-Saharan African countries, lack of financing, and insufficient healthcare infrastructure impede access to quality generic medicines. Low-income countries across various regions, including parts of Asia and Latin America, struggle with access to generics due to high out-of-pocket costs for patients, tariffs on imported medicines, and limited availability of essential drugs. We anticipate that new regional and national initiatives will be developed, targeting improving regulatory capacities, establishing better procurement practices, negotiating price reductions, and encouraging local production of generic medicines.

Victoza is not approved for weight management, the aspect of GLP-1 that is recently of interest, nor will Victoza likely gain approval for such an indication based on its existing clinical trial results. With the prevalence of T2D increasing globally, the demand for effective and affordable treatments is expected to rise, creating a sizeable market for generics. Recent studies reveal concerning trends in the availability and pricing of generic drugs for Hepatitis B and C. Despite reduced pharmacy prices, out-of-pocket costs for entecavir, a generic Hepatitis B antiviral, increased for privately insured patients from 2014 to 2018. Additionally, certain Medicare Part D plans failed to cover generic Hepatitis C drugs in 2019, resulting in missed savings opportunities.
